Abstract

System for the unión of reinforced concrete plates in prefabricated buildings. This joining system of reinforced concrete plates (1), of which include a reinforcement of steel bar systems (2) and a fence (5) composed of a metal profile of u-shaped cross section that receives it, consists of that a plate is provided with one or more plates (9) included in the concrete mass and fixed to one of said bar systems (2) and/or one or more plates (11) fixed perpendicularly to the frame (5), all this is adapted so that the strips (11) fixed to the frame (5) of a first plate (8) are confronted with corresponding strips (9) included in the concrete mass and fixed to a system of bars of a second plate (7). ) disposed perpendicularly with respect to the first one, said facing plates (9, 11) disposing of respective and complementary joining means. Applicable to prefabricated buildings. (Machine-translation by Google Translate, not legally binding)

A wide variety of prefabricated constructions of modular design is widely known. This type of construction is already widespread in both the construction of residential complexes, such as single-family residences and housing blocks, and in constructions for general services, such as in educational centers, offices and buildings for use industrial among many
others.

The characteristics described above of the system for joining reinforced concrete slabs in prefabricated constructions object of the invention provides an innovative solution to the problems posed by the distribution and joining of plates in a prefabricated construction. According to the system of the invention, a plate may for example be provided with a plurality of plates included in the concrete mass and another plate may be provided with a plurality of plates attached to the fence thereof, the plates being provided with a and another plate so that they allow their mutual union by means of screws. In this way, the system of the invention allows the mutual union of pairs of plates arranged orthogonally to each other, and this by means of plates included in the concrete mass of a plate and corresponding plates fixed to the fence of the other plate, using for said union
screws

La placa de hormigón armado 1 está provisto de un cerco 5 constituido por un perfil de acero en U, tal como se aprecia en la Fig. 2, que recubre perimetralmente la placa de hormigón armado 1, estando el cerco 5 unido a los sistemas de barras de acero 2 del armado mediante puentes en U 6.In Figs. 1 and 2 view shown in plan and in longitudinal section respectively a plate of reinforced concrete 1 intended for use in buildings prefabricated These figures show that the concrete plate 1 comprises an assembly consisting of two equal systems of bars of steel and which are indicated with reference 2; each system of steel bars 2 is formed by a first group of bars 3 steel arranged parallel to each other regularly distributed and to along the plate 1, and by a second group of steel bars 4 also arranged parallel to each other and regularly distributed and transversal with respect to bars 3, the second group being 4 steel bars joined by electric welding to the first group of steel bars 3. The reinforced concrete plate 1 is provided with a fence 5 constituted by a U-shaped steel profile, as It can be seen in Fig. 2, that it perimetrically covers the plate of reinforced concrete 1, the fence 5 being attached to the bar systems of steel 2 of the assembly by means of bridges in U 6.

In this example of embodiment described, it is envisioned that the plate reinforced concrete 7 is arranged horizontally, while the reinforced concrete plate 8 is arranged vertically with respect to reinforced concrete plate 7. This arrangement of plates reinforced concrete is given by way of example only, since the reinforced concrete slabs can take each other positions different, for example, two concrete plates can be arranged armed vertical perpendicular to each other, for the formation of enclosures

The number and arrangement of pairs of plates 9 of the reinforced concrete plate 7 horizontal is given depending on the number and position of vertical reinforced concrete plates 8 that they must be attached to the reinforced concrete plate 7 horizontal. The plates 9 are fixed by electric welding to the group of 3 and / or 4 steel bars of one of the reinforcement bar systems of the plate, realizing the union below the bars that they form the groups of bars and so that the plate is arranged by one of its faces flush with the surface of the plate reinforced concrete. Each plate 9 has a through hole provided of a threaded thread 10. Preferably each plate 9 has a width / length ratio of 1/2 and a thickness of 10 mm.

The plates 11 of each pair of plates are arranged one on each side of fence 5, coplanar to each other and perpendicular to the arms of the U of the profile of fence 5 and facing each other respectfully, each plate 11 being provided with a through hole 12. Preferably, and in correspondence with the plates 9 of the plate of reinforced concrete 7, each plate 11 has a relationship width / length of ½ and a thickness of 10 mm. As seen in Fig. 5, the pairs of plates 11 of the reinforced concrete plate 8 vertical correspond in position with the pairs of plates 9 included in the concrete mass of the reinforced concrete plate 7 horizontal.

It is understood that the same plate of reinforced concrete can be provided with plates included in the mass of concrete and plates attached to the fence, and so in order to confer on the concrete plate some benefits that allow its positioning and joining with another or other concrete plates for Any configuration of concrete construction plates prefabricated.
